What equipment do I need to start filming my cooking videos?

To start filming your cooking videos, you don’t need overly expensive equipment. A good quality camera or smartphone with a decent camera can suffice for recording. Ensure that the lighting is adequate by filming near natural light sources or investing in softbox lights for better visibility. Clear and appealing visuals are essential for cooking content, so prioritize good lighting and a clean background.

Additionally, consider using a tripod to stabilize your camera, ensuring that your footage is steady. A good microphone can greatly enhance your audio quality, making it easier for your audience to follow along with your instructions. As you progress, you might choose to invest in more advanced equipment like a DSLR camera or professional lighting setups, but starting small can be effective as you gain experience and confidence.

Can I use copyrighted music in my Cooking Channel videos?

Using copyrighted music in your Cooking Channel videos without permission can lead to your content being flagged or removed. It’s important to use music that you have the rights to, either by creating your own, purchasing licenses for specific tracks, or using royalty-free music libraries. Many platforms offer vast collections of music that you can use without worrying about copyright issues, ensuring that your content remains compliant.

Alternatively, consider using music that is labeled as “Creative Commons,” which allows for certain uses as long as you provide appropriate credit. Always verify the terms of any music before incorporating it into your videos, as different licenses may have specific requirements. This approach not only protects you legally but also contributes to a more professional-sounding production.
